In addition to time constraints and anxiety, students … Web15 aug. 2024 · The SAT consists of two sections: Math and Evidence-Based Reading and Writing (EBRW). You'll receive a score for each section between 200 and 800. Those two section scores are then added together to give you a total SAT score out of 1600. Web7 nov. 2024 · To get a total pixel count, you simply multiply the two together, and that’s it. A 1920×1080 image has over 2 million pixels. Conversely, a 1600×900 image has a little less than 1.5 million. If more pixels lead to a better resolution, 1920×1080 is clearly superior.
